Bug Description
Hardy version has a bug that won't advertise ipv6 routes.
This was fixed in a later quagga version, can't remember the exact one.
I do know that it's fixed and works fine in karmic (intrepid also I believe)
If I'm reading the changelog correctly, 0.99.10 fixed it (hardy has 0.99.9)
[bgpd] Fix typo, which prevented advertisement of MP (non-IPv4) prefixes
